Commit Graph

  • 029def30ce Import Pygments 1.4 lexers Joshua Peek 2011-05-19 23:22:44 -05:00
  • a54ef7ebda Add rake task for pgyments lexers Joshua Peek 2011-05-19 23:22:10 -05:00
  • c532c319a1 Add pygments lexer dump script Joshua Peek 2011-05-19 23:21:45 -05:00
  • 81d0206c40 Detect generated xcode files Joshua Peek 2011-05-19 22:52:27 -05:00
  • 92dc3a47f4 Fix Shell lexer Joshua Peek 2011-05-16 22:51:41 -04:00
  • 09f8b1fb24 Language[] finds by lexer too Joshua Peek 2011-05-16 22:41:02 -04:00
  • b22263718d Separate special_mime_type method Joshua Peek 2011-05-16 21:03:55 -04:00
  • 8d5dc01363 Extract BlobHelper mixin Joshua Peek 2011-05-13 17:02:50 -05:00
  • fcc2bc172f Separate Blob name and pathname Joshua Peek 2011-05-13 16:20:15 -05:00
  • 5edd3a02be Detect language from shebang script Joshua Peek 2011-05-13 16:18:30 -05:00
  • 74b26fdfc9 Add Blob#loc and Blob#sloc Joshua Peek 2011-05-13 15:12:40 -05:00
  • d8ee0dc9d5 Use blob basename Joshua Peek 2011-05-13 14:26:20 -05:00
  • d4d58e0cce Add Blob#disposition Joshua Peek 2011-05-13 14:15:45 -05:00
  • dfc13c1524 Depend on escape_utils Joshua Peek 2011-05-13 14:11:32 -05:00
  • 83150900fa Test nil mime lookup Joshua Peek 2011-05-13 14:02:01 -05:00
  • fe9a387e8c Remove mime type from blob Joshua Peek 2011-05-13 13:59:59 -05:00
  • 0f1a303c63 Lock to mime types 1.15 Joshua Peek 2011-05-13 13:59:39 -05:00
  • 28e36b279d Don't need to support mime fallback Joshua Peek 2011-05-13 13:33:04 -05:00
  • dec56649b2 Add Blob#binary? Joshua Peek 2011-05-13 12:54:16 -05:00
  • 6ead7d8f37 Move tests to blob Joshua Peek 2011-05-13 12:46:57 -05:00
  • 0009cbab89 Basic blob tests Joshua Peek 2011-05-13 12:43:16 -05:00
  • d07d457677 Add Pathname#== Joshua Peek 2011-05-13 12:41:38 -05:00
  • 39bd49950e Add Blob Joshua Peek 2011-05-11 22:08:12 -05:00
  • b424c32bb4 Add file?, text? and image? helpers Joshua Peek 2011-05-11 17:08:46 -05:00
  • 7f8d0f611e Register war and ear as java Joshua Peek 2011-05-11 16:22:15 -05:00
  • 90c5e468be Require mime Joshua Peek 2011-05-11 16:20:59 -05:00
  • eb6df1a6f6 Ignore Gemfile.lock Joshua Peek 2011-05-11 16:19:16 -05:00
  • 333d10f4aa Depend on mime-types gem Joshua Peek 2011-05-11 16:18:07 -05:00
  • d655925023 Add Gemfile Joshua Peek 2011-05-11 16:17:26 -05:00
  • aac2ed2d20 Add special mime type overrides Joshua Peek 2011-05-11 16:14:43 -05:00
  • 8e7274e07a Add Pathname#mime_type Joshua Peek 2011-05-11 15:37:06 -05:00
  • 8cf2aad461 language falls back to text Joshua Peek 2011-05-11 14:43:54 -05:00
  • 62894ad13c Return 'text' for missing lexer Joshua Peek 2011-05-11 14:35:08 -05:00
  • 3ee7657bae 'text' should be the default lexer Joshua Peek 2011-05-11 14:34:39 -05:00
  • 9915d57045 Remove lexer <=> name helpers Joshua Peek 2011-05-11 14:15:05 -05:00
  • f4d2a8cdcd Remove Language#lexers Joshua Peek 2011-05-11 14:10:33 -05:00
  • c2e5065ce1 Add list of popular languages Joshua Peek 2011-05-11 12:49:51 -05:00
  • 6a9d31737a Add name <=> lexer helpers Joshua Peek 2011-05-11 12:19:21 -05:00
  • faef901159 Pathname depends on Language Joshua Peek 2011-05-10 10:27:51 -05:00
  • ef1ea9a0c9 Language#eql? Joshua Peek 2011-05-10 10:01:55 -05:00
  • 68718812bc Add Pathname#lexer and Pathname#lexer_name Joshua Peek 2011-05-10 09:46:44 -05:00
  • de8bf008ef Replace Language#find_by_filename with Pathname#language Joshua Peek 2011-05-10 09:40:35 -05:00
  • 86c67f4b6f Add Pathname Joshua Peek 2011-05-10 09:27:18 -05:00
  • 74d121507e Copy some test cases over Joshua Peek 2011-05-10 09:21:30 -05:00
  • 712fc91648 Expose lexer list Joshua Peek 2011-05-09 23:55:33 -05:00
  • 0e2f29e0d6 Require language Joshua Peek 2011-05-09 23:43:31 -05:00
  • c37c10a4ab Add Language#find_by_lexer Joshua Peek 2011-05-09 23:31:57 -05:00
  • 7c0fe466a4 Add Language#lexer Joshua Peek 2011-05-09 23:12:37 -05:00
  • 09618cfed5 Extract a separate method for find_by_filename Joshua Peek 2011-05-09 23:06:58 -05:00
  • fdc8f18c52 Raise an error is Language#name is missing Joshua Peek 2011-05-09 23:03:30 -05:00
  • 6041dda7ca Add Language#find_by_extension Joshua Peek 2011-05-09 22:56:28 -05:00
  • 80ff3883ac Add Language#extensions Joshua Peek 2011-05-09 22:39:32 -05:00
  • 34b8d422bd Make Language#find_by_name case insensitive Joshua Peek 2011-05-09 22:28:56 -05:00
  • 0798411814 Test Language#name Joshua Peek 2011-05-09 22:25:54 -05:00
  • a1e3b86427 Add Language class Joshua Peek 2011-05-09 22:25:44 -05:00
  • 37243ec6be Import extensions config Joshua Peek 2011-05-09 22:25:33 -05:00
  • 643d72bb4c Add test unit runner Joshua Peek 2011-05-09 22:18:55 -05:00
  • d1fd619218 Define Linguist module Joshua Peek 2011-05-09 22:04:14 -05:00
  • e192b79ffc Add basic gemspec Joshua Peek 2011-05-09 21:59:42 -05:00
  • 559097ed6b first commit Joshua Peek 2011-05-09 17:53:41 -05:00